Using Piezoelectric Film to Capture Voltage
Abstract:
Piezoelectric Film is an enabling transducer technology with unique capabilities. Piezoelectric Film produces voltage in proportion to compressive or tensile mechanical stress or strain, making it an ideal dynamic strain gage. It makes a highly reliable, low-cost vibration sensor, accelerometer or dynamic switch element. Piezo Film is also ideally suited for high fidelity transducers operating throughout the high audio (>1kHz) and ultrasonic (up to 100MHz) ranges. The Piezoelectric Film can become a power source that can be used to power another device. By flexing the PVDF film a voltage is created, that voltage can then be captured and stored until needed.
